What is an American-Style Fridge Freezer?

An American-style fridge freezer is a large home appliance that typically features a side-by-side or French door style with a fridge compartment on one side and a freezer compartment on the other. These models offer generous storage area, modern innovation, and a variety of personalized functions, making them perfect for households and those who enjoy to captivate.

Why Choose an American-Style Fridge Freezer?

  1. Space Saving: An American-style fridge freezer optimizes storage space with large door compartments and adjustable shelving. This is especially useful for storing bigger items like party plates, wine bottles, and bulk purchases.

  2. Home entertainment Ready: The generous capability permits property owners to stockpile on beverages and food, making them perfect for events and household occasions.

  3. Advanced Features: Many designs come equipped with features such as water and ice dispensers, clever controls, and double temperature level zones, improving the overall user experience.

  4. Visual Appeal: Their sleek and modern style includes a touch of elegance to any kitchen area layout.

Secret Factors to Consider When Buying

When aiming to acquire an American-style fridge freezer, there are a number of elements to think about ensuring you select the best model for your home:

  1. Size and Dimensions:

    • Measure Your Space: Before making a purchase, it's necessary to measure the offered space in your kitchen.
    • Door Swing: Ensure there's adequate area for door swings and that it won't obstruct any kitchen pathways.
  2. Capacity:

    • Families of four or more might benefit from larger capability models (around 600 liters), while smaller families might find 400-500 liters enough.
  3. Energy Efficiency:

    • Look for designs with an Energy Star score, which suggests that they consume less energy and can save you money in the long run.
  4. Style Preferences:

    • Decide between a side-by-side, French door, or even a bottom-freezer model based upon your storage choices and kitchen design.
  5. Functions:

    • Consider which features are most important to you. Do you desire a water and ice dispenser? Smart innovation? Adjustable shelving?
  6. Rate:

    • Set a budget plan in advance. American-style fridge freezers can range widely in cost, so understand what you're prepared to invest.

Common FAQs About American-Style Fridge Freezers

1. Just how much area do I require for an American-style fridge freezer?

It's suggested to have at least 5-10 cm of clearance around the device for ventilation. Step thoroughly, considering any door openings and cabinets.

2. Are American-style fridge freezers energy-efficient?

Many designs are Energy Star certified, indicating they consume less energy compared to older models. Always check the Energy Guide label for estimated annual operating expenses.

3. What if I have a smaller sized cooking area?

While American-style fridge freezers are large, lots of manufacturers offer counter-depth designs that fit more snuggly into your kitchen area design.

4. How often should I defrost my fridge freezer?

A lot of modern fridge freezers are self-defrosting. Nevertheless, if your model requires manual defrosting, it should be done every 6 months or when the frost accumulation exceeds 1/4 inch.

5. Can I utilize a water filter for my ice and water dispenser?

Yes, many American-style fridge freezers include water and ice dispensers that utilize filters to make sure clean and fresh water. Replacing the filter routinely is key for upkeep.

6. What's the best way to keep my fridge freezer?

Routinely clean the exterior and interior, thaw when required, and keep the coils tidy. This guarantees optimum performance and prolongs the life-span of the appliance.
